Battery
The battery could require replacement if your key fob does not turn on or it takes some time to lock or unlock doors, or even start your car. A new battery can fix the problem. However, first you'll need to determine if the battery is the culprit.
You can find a new battery for your Hyundai keyfob at any hardware store or department store. You can also purchase the batteries online or at your local drugstores and supermarkets. You will require a CR2032 lithium-ion 3 volt coin cell battery. This is the same battery type that is used in watches and calculators.
After you have removed the old battery and opened the case that houses your key fob and gently lift the circuit board. Take a picture or note down how the battery is positioned inside the case before you remove it, as it will help you insert the new battery in properly. The CR2032 is the most common size of battery used in Hyundai key fobs. It's simple to locate and can be found in Havelock. After you've put in the new battery in the key fob, test it to determine if it's working properly.
